Here's the deal:
I'm currently driving a 93 hatch with a d15z1. Of course I want more power, and I know I can swap in a b series or whatever, but that is a quite expensive thing to do over here, so I'm thinking why not try to do something out of what I got?
The d15z1 rods are the same specs as the rods in a JDM d15b VTEC, 137mm. If i slap in a set of jdm d15b pistons, I will pretty much have a JDM d15b block, right? Next step is to put on a d16z6 (because that is the easiest thing to get where I live) head, IM, TB, ECU and vtec solenoid. And of course I need a Si/Ex tranny.
Will this setup work?
Oh, BTW, what are the jdm pistons called? P08?
